Q: How do evaporative cooling pads work to reduce temperature and add humidity?
A: Evaporative cooling pads function by allowing air to pass through their wetted surfaces, causing water to evaporate and absorb heat from the air. This results in lower air temperature and increased humidity-making spaces cooler and more comfortable, especially in hot and dry environments.

Q: When should I replace or maintain the evaporative cooling pads?
A: For optimal performance, cooling pads should be inspected regularly-typically every 6 to 12 months depending on usage and water quality. Replace the pads if you notice significant clogging, reduced cooling effectiveness, or physical deterioration.

Q: What is the process for installing an evaporative cooling pad system?
A: Installation involves mounting the pads within a suitable frame, connecting a water distribution system to keep them adequately wetted, and ensuring airflow via fans or blowers. Professional installation is advisable to guarantee efficiency and prevent leakage or uneven air distribution.
